Yandex has added technology for automatic off-screen translation of live broadcasts on YouTube to its proprietary browser. Currently, the function works in test mode with restrictions and not on all channels.

The list includes solutions from Apple, Google, TechCrunch, NASA, SpaceX, IGN, and more. The technology allows translating streams from five European languages. In the near future, the company plans to add Asian ones, but it is not reported when exactly this will happen.

Yandex calls its next step the simultaneous translation of streaming broadcasts and videos not only on YouTube, but also on Twitch.

“We taught neural networks to translate broadcasts in English, German, French, Italian and Spanish. Next, we will add new pairs of European languages, as well as Chinese, Japanese and others.”

Yandex notes that support for translating streams to Twitch will take a long time. It probably won’t happen before 2023.
